A truely magical stay, from the seemingly never ending view of Australian bush, down to the details of the interior. Every little aspect of rehab155 has been created with so much love and care, there’s a little piece of history and a story behind every aspect of the apartment. Not only is it visually beautiful, but the host Matthew made sure I was well looked after, with baked goods and also a well stocked kitchen with all the spices, herbs and pantry essentials (which were all either home grown and harvested by Matthew or locally sourced from ethical farms). The self sufficient and sustainable build of the apartment took all the guilt away from indulging (especially in the GIANT bathtub) and truly let me relax and unwind. I couldn’t have wished for a more perfect escape. I will definitely be back to make use of the kayaks, and can’t wait to experience the beautiful landscape during a different season. Also would recommend baking some potatoes in the fireplace and topping it with Matthews home churned butter 👌

We had a magical stay at this amazing light-filled apartment, surrounded by nature, watching the mist roll in and watching kangaroos and other wildlife from our bed! Loved the decor, how private it was, and the many thoughtful and delicious inclusions like firewood and Matthew’s home-made bread and cookies, home-grown fruit, and coffee. There is even a massive passionfruit vine groaning with ripe fruit we were free to feast on (yum!!!). And all this just 10 minutes drive from the 12 Apostles. While there’s plenty of other attractions nearby (the Redwood Forest is well worth a visit), we really enjoyed spending part of every day just hanging out in the cabin. Matthew is a delight who is happy to share his knowledge of the area if you have any questions. If you get the chance to eat any of the meals he offers, grab it. The pot stickers (dumplings) were our fav. Sooooo good. Thanks Matthew for a very memorable escape.

Destination M was the destination to be! such an amazing spot! A wonderful accommodation. Matthew was a fantastic host and we were spoilt with a greeting with fresh honey and then many more home made treats to follow. The accommodation was on a hill top with spectacular views of the Forrest. The first morning I was woken up my the sun rising over the mountains followed by some deer just outside the window and on our last day we had a little Echidna friend wish us fare well :) The location was about 15 minutes from the 12 Apostles and easy drives to many wonderful site seeing spots. After the day could relax in the massive bath by the fire. The accommodation was great fun with lots of things to do! board and card games, DVDS and projector and music sound systems. It really had it all :) Our only regret is that we didn't stay longer!
